Subject: Re: [PATCH net 1/4] bridge: Don't use VID 0 and 4095 in vlan filtering

On 09/10/2013 06:32 AM, Toshiaki Makita wrote:
> IEEE 802.1Q says that:
> - VID 0 shall not be configured as a PVID, or configured in any Filtering
> Database entry.
> - VID 4095 shall not be configured as a PVID, or transmitted in a tag
> header. This VID value may be used to indicate a wildcard match for the VID
> in management operations or Filtering Database entries.
> (See IEEE 802.1Q-2005 6.7.1 and Table 9-2)
>
> Don't accept adding these VIDs in the vlan_filtering implementation.
